    Im using a 70 degree bucking on this stock currently and the shots are all over the place. Is this because I should be using a 60 degree? I have a 150% spring on the way but I was just wondering if thr fps for each degree effects the accuracy.

    • @AngryBullAirsoft
      @AngryBullAirsoft  3 роки тому +1

      Nah, bucking degree only affects how much backspin goes on the BB. If the shots are all over, try having a look at cleaning through the barrel and maybe see if the nozzle is sealing into the bucking.

    Do you know if the cowcow glock short stroke kit fits these?

    • @AngryBullAirsoft
      @AngryBullAirsoft  3 роки тому +1

      They definitely don't I'm afraid. Needs to be a custom shape to fit against the BBU. There are lots of AAP specific ones on eBay or you can 3D print yourself if you have a printer.
